29#include <sys/cdefs.h>
30__FBSDID("$FreeBSD: head/bin/uuidgen/uuidgen.c 97372 2002-05-28 06:16:08Z marcel $");
31
32#include <sys/types.h>
33#include <sys/endian.h>
34#include <sys/uuid.h>
35
36#include <err.h>
37#include <stdio.h>
38#include <stdlib.h>
39#include <unistd.h>
40
41static void
42usage(void)
43{
44	(void)fprintf(stderr, "usage: uuidgen [-1] [-n count]\n");
45	exit(1);
46}
47
48static void
49uuid_print(uuid_t *uuid)
50{
51	printf("%08x-%04x-%04x-%02x%02x-", uuid->time_low, uuid->time_mid,
52	    uuid->time_hi_and_version, uuid->clock_seq_hi_and_reserved,
53	    uuid->clock_seq_low);
54	printf("%02x%02x%02x%02x%02x%02x\n", uuid->node[0], uuid->node[1],
55	    uuid->node[2], uuid->node[3], uuid->node[4], uuid->node[5]);
56}
57
58int
59main(int argc, char *argv[])
60{
61	uuid_t *store, *uuid;
62	char *p;
63	int ch, count, i, iterate;
64
65	count = -1;	/* no count yet */
66	iterate = 0;	/* not one at a time */
67	while ((ch = getopt(argc, argv, "1n:")) != -1)
68		switch (ch) {
69		case '1':
70			iterate = 1;
71			break;
72		case 'n':
73			if (count > 0)
74				usage();
75			count = strtol(optarg, &p, 10);
76			if (*p != 0 || count < 1)
77				usage();
78			break;
79		default:
80			usage();
81		}
82	argv += optind;
83	argc -= optind;
84
85	if (argc)
86		usage();
87
88	if (count == -1)
89		count = 1;
90
91	store = (uuid_t*)malloc(sizeof(uuid_t) * count);
92	if (store == NULL)
93		err(1, "malloc()");
94
95	if (!iterate) {
96		/* Get them all in a single batch */
97		if (uuidgen(store, count) != 0)
98			err(1, "uuidgen()");
99	} else {
100		uuid = store;
101		for (i = 0; i < count; i++) {
102			if (uuidgen(uuid++, 1) != 0)
103				err(1, "uuidgen()");
104		}
105	}
106
107	uuid = store;
108	while (count--)
109		uuid_print(uuid++);
110
111	free(store);
112	return (0);
113}
